DAILY COMMODITY GOLD TIPS & SILVER REPORT FOR 19/08/2014

Precious Metals
D A I L Y B U Z Z 
GOLD 
Gold prices fell 0.82 per cent to Rs 28,420 per 10 grams in futures trade today amid a weak trend overseas and profit-booking by speculators. 

At the Multi Commodity Exchange, Gold for delivery in December fell by Rs 236, or 0.82 per cent, to Rs 28,420 per 10 grams in a business turnover of 14 lots. 

Likewise, the metal for delivery in October shed Rs 224, or 0.78 per cent, to Rs 28,390 per 10 grams in 537 lots. 

Analysts said besides profit-booking by speculators, a weak trend in the overseas markets as the outlook for an improving US economy outweighed tension in Ukraine, weighed on gold prices at futures trade here. 

Globally, gold traded 0.6 per cent lower at USD 1,297.46 an ounce Singapore today. 

Agro Outlook 

CARDAMOM 
Cardamom prices surged 2.35 per cent to Rs 945.20 per kg in futures trade today as speculators created positions amid strong demand in the spot markets supported by festive season. 

At the Multi Commodity Exchange, cardamom for delivery in far-month October shot up by Rs 21.70, or 2.35 per cent to Rs 945.20 per kg in business turnover of 62 lots. 

In a similar fashion, the spice for delivery in September contract gained Rs 13.80, or 1.48 per cent to Rs 944 per kg in 243 lots. 

Market analysts said fresh positions created by speculators driven by rising demand in the spot markets in view of festive season mainly led to the rise in cardamom prices at futures trade.

MCX Commodity Market Updates Today 04 April 2013


Silver prices fell by 1.10 per cent to Rs 51,984 per kg in futures trade today as speculators trimmed their positions largely in tune with a weakening trend overseas after a stronger dollar reduced demand for safe haven. At the Multi Commodity Exchange, Silver for delivery in far-month July traded lower by Rs 577, or 1.10 per cent, to Rs 51,984 per kg in business turnover of 190 lots. Similarly, the white metal for delivery in May declined by Rs 553, or 1.07 per cent, to Rs 50,920 per kg in business volume of 2,844 lots.

Taking cues from global markets and subdued demand from domestic consuming industries, lead prices eased by 0.31 per cent to Rs 112.50 per kg in futures trade today as speculators reduced their exposures. At the Multi Commodity Exchange, lead for delivery in May fell 35 paise, or 0.31 per cent, to Rs 112.50 per kg in business turnover of 91 lots. On similar lines, the metal for delivery in April shed 30 paise, or 0.27 per cent, to Rs 111.85 per kg in 1,862 lots. 
Amid a weak trend in the global markets and subdued domestic demand, nickel prices dropped 0.67 per cent to Rs 889.90 per kg in futures trade today as speculators reduced their positions. At the Multi Commodity Exchange, nickel for delivery in April dropped by Rs 4, or 0.67 per cent, to Rs 889.90 per kg in a business turnover of 716 lots. The metal for delivery in May also fell by Rs 6.10, or 0.67 per cent, to Rs 898.20 per kg in a turnover of 102 lots.
